Abstract

Objectives: To present results of surgery performed at the ENT clinic in C.H. V.N. Gaia/Espinho and their quality scores.

Methods: Pediatric Population underwent surgery in ENT clinic in CHVN G / E. between May 2009 and December 2010. We performed a retrospective analysis of data from medical records and telephone survey.

Results: We analyzed a population of 121 patients, 40.5% of whom underwent adenotonsillectomy, 21.5% with TTT’s adenoidectomy, adenoidectomy alone 12.4% and 25.6% other. There were no immediate or late complications in 57% and 80.2% of cases. Pain was the most frequent complaint in both periods (32,2%). The overall level of satisfaction was very satisfied in 89.3% of cases.

Conclusions: The low complication rate and high level of satisfaction demonstrates the advantages of outpatient surgery in management of resources, quality and safety of services provided.
